Rival Says Karzai Brother to Withdraw From Afghan Presidential Race

Afghan Voice Agency (AVA), International Service , 5 Mar 2014 - 14:52


The Afghan president's brother is preparing to withdraw from the presidential elections according to a rival candidate, former Foreign Minister Zalmay Rassoul, who said the two were planning an alliance and would join forces soon.

“We are in discussions about how we can join together, we have not reached yet a final result, but it is on the way,” Rassoul said in an interview on the sidelines of a debate.

“Our negotiation is not finalized ... but you will know very soon,” he said.

With just one month to go until the vote on April 5, just three candidates appeared for Tuesday's televised debate on foreign policy, broadcast by Afghanistan's most popular channel.

Rassoul and Karzai both belong to the same majority Pashtun ethnic group as the president, and an alliance between leading Pashtun candidates has been the focus of heated speculation in the capital as the election approaches.
